Pork, Pears and Parsnips
 
recipe image
Prep Time: 0 Minutes
Cook Time: 30 Minutes
Ready In: 30 Minutes
Servings: 4
Serve your family this delicious English-inspired pork dish, which has a mustard and maple syrup glaze,
Ingredients:
1 tablespoon vegetable oil
4 pork loin, centre chops bone-in (about 2 lb.)
salt and pepper
3 firm slightly under-ripe pears, peeled
1 1/2 lbs parsnips peeled and cut into 2 12 by 1/2 -inch sticks (about 7 medium)
6 tablespoons grainy mustard
1/4 cup maple syrup
1/2 teaspoon crushed mustard
Directions:
1. Brush roasting pan with 1 tsp of the oil.
2. Place pork chops in pan; season with salt and pepper.
3. Cut pears into quarters and remove cores; cut each 1quarter in half, In a small bowl, toss parsnips with remaining oil.
4. Place pears and parsnips on and around chops.
5. Cover with foil and bake in a 375F oven for about 20 minutes.
6. GLAZE: In a small bowl, whisk together mustard, maple syrup and garlic; brush over pork chops, pears and parsnips.
7. Bake, uncovered, for 5-10 minutes more or until parsniips are tender and juices run clear when pork is pierced and just a hint of pink remains inside.
